The PXI Multifunction DAQ model PXI-6280, under part number 191501F-04 (779120-01), is designed for a wide range of applications requiring high-speed data acquisition and processing. This device is equipped with 16 analog inputs, providing the capability to capture a multitude of signals for processing and analysis. Alongside, it offers 24 digital I/O channels, allowing for versatile digital interactions and control mechanisms within your setup.
The PXI-6280 utilizes a unique pulse quantification technique for high frequency signals, which involves generating a pulse of unknown duration (T) to the Gate of a counter. This allows for precise measurement and analysis of high-speed signals. Additionally, the device supports one counter channel, which can be used to produce pulses remotely, enhancing its functionality in various measurement scenarios.
When it comes to decoding motion or positioning, the PXI-6280 employs a quadrature cycle method. This method increments the counter when channel A leads B and decrements when B leads A, allowing for accurate tracking of movement direction and distance. The encoding type utilized by the device depends on the measure of additions and decrements per cycle, offering flexibility in signal processing.
Furthermore, the PXI-6280 features a two-signal edge-separation estimation capability. This function uses Signals-Aux and Gate, starting the measurement with an Aux edge and stopping with a Gate edge. This feature is particularly useful for precise timing measurements between two signal events, enhancing the device’s utility in complex data acquisition tasks.
